thecrane wrote:shit, i always thought rootsman and the bug were the same person kevin martin??
They're two different people, but it's easy to get them confused in this case, as Razor X Productions essentially is The Bug and Rootsman. So the Killing Sound CD is actually credited to "The Bug VS Rootsman".
